What this is

Therapy that goes
beneath insight.

Weekly IFS therapy is relational, experiential, and trauma-focused. We slow down, turn toward the parts that are hurting, and do the real work of healing — not just gaining insight about why you do what you do, but actually meeting the parts that drive it.

We follow trailheads as they arise week by week — integrating nervous system regulation, attachment repair, and deeper parts work. This is where you learn to recognize your protectors, connect with younger parts, and build lasting Self-leadership.

How I work

The approach.

I don't believe there is a universal approach to healing. Each person's system is different — shaped by different experiences, organized around different protectors, ready to move at its own pace.

Internal Family Systems

Parts work, Self-energy, inner relationship building

EMDR

Trauma reprocessing, targeting stuck memories

AEDP

Accelerated experiential relational repair

Attachment & Somatic

Nervous system regulation, embodied safety
